A gay men STD screening may require more than a basic urine test. Some sexually transmitted infections (STIs) can hide in the throat or rectum. You could test negative on a standard screen while an infection remains untreated.
Urine testing can detect some infections, but it does not always check the throat or rectum.
Sexual activity can expose different areas to STIs. Gonorrhea and chlamydia can affect the throat or rectum.
